Running ld with -r switches the linker to a very special mode where some other linker options don't make sense. In particular, -export-dynamic normally requires that all global symbols be included in the dynamic symbol table, but a .o file doesn't even have a dynamic symbol table. When given both options it looks like the gnu linker just ignores -export-dynamic. Unfortunately some versions of lld (https://lld.llvm.org/) have a bug that causes it to try to create a dynamic symbol table in the output .o file and ends up corrupting it (https://bugs.llvm.org/show_bug.cgi?id=43552). Current (git) version of lld now issues an error. This patch filters out -export-dynamic from $(LDFLAGS) when using -r. With this patch I can build dpdk with lld.
